微信小程序 数据请求

在微信小程序中想要对其他接口进行数据请求,首先在【微信公众平台】中登录小程序,

微信公众平台的地址为:微信公众平台 (qq.com),在服务器域名中配置request合法域名,配置完后,在自己的微信小程序右侧的【详情】页面可以看到刚刚配置的域名,到此,准备工作结束。

在微信小程序的数据请求中,有两点必须注意:

1、请求的接口必须使用https

2、接口地址中不能使用ip地址或者localhost,必须使用域名

开始正式的程序开发。

GET请求:

wxml

复制代码
<button bindtap="getUserInfo">GET请求</button>

在对应的.js文件中

javascript 复制代码
getUserInfo(){
    wx.request({
      url: 'url/api/get',
      method:"GET",
      data:{
        name:"张三",
        age:23
      },
      success:(res)=>{
        console.log(res.data)
      }
    })
  },

url代表调用的地址

method声明使用的是GET请求,

data是数据

采用success回调函数获取接口返回的数据

POST请求

post请求与get请求类似

在wxml中

javascript 复制代码
<button bindtap="postUserInfo">POST请求</button>

在对应的.js中

javascript 复制代码
postUserInfo(){
    wx.request({
      url: 'url/api/post',
      method:"POST",
      data:{
        name:"张三",
        age:23
      },
      success:(res)=>{
        console.log(res.data)
      }
    })
  }

url代表调用的地址

method声明使用的是POST请求,

data是数据

采用success回调函数获取接口返回的数据

如果想在页面加载时就进行数据请求,将请求的方法放在.js文件中的onLoad()中即可。
相关推荐
潆润千川科技18 分钟前
中老年垂直社交小程序产品功能对比与设计思路分析
小程序
木风未来26 分钟前
解锁自然新可能:露营租赁小程序如何让轻量化户外触手可及
小程序
木风未来4 小时前
破解家政维修信任困局:一个小程序如何让家庭服务更透明、更高效
小程序
Java.慈祥6 小时前
速通-微信小程序 5Day
java·微信小程序·小程序·npm
说私域6 小时前
数字围城下的防御与突围:基于私域流量与智能名片商城小程序的用户关系重构研究
小程序·重构·流量运营·私域运营
未来之窗软件服务7 小时前
服务器运维(三十四)小程序web访问慢ssl优化—东方仙盟
运维·服务器·小程序·仙盟创梦ide·东方仙盟
全栈小57 小时前
【小程序】微信小程序slice方法分割无效,单独输出一直为空,这是为什么呢
微信小程序·小程序·数组分割
Light607 小时前
心智有效性测试小程序 V1.0 产品白皮书——心智结构量化与系统稳定性评估平台
小程序·apache
予你@。8 小时前
uni-app(Vue3)实现自定义 Tab 切换滑块效果(微信小程序)
vue.js·微信小程序·uni-app
说私域8 小时前
数字商超的崛起:基于“链动2+1模式智能名片S2B2C商城小程序”的社交电商生态重构
人工智能·小程序·重构·流量运营